Most Blizzard games generate an error log file, located in the main directory, whenever a crash occurs. Navigate to your Warcraft 3 directory and look for an "Errors" folder, or something along those lines. If found, open it up and look for some error log files; you should be able to open them in Notepad. Post some of them here.

Along with this, generally whenever your computer experiences a crash, it creates a log in the Event Log; goto Start --> Run --> type EVENTVWR and press OK --> Now, look under the System and Application logs for any errors and/or warnings. If you find any, please post the relevant heading, along with the details inside by double clicking on the error/warning, and then copy/pasting the information from within.
